Output 28158bbb7f84c113183d7e5783137067c79cf4d00a12dcb6ec8548fc6d852b8d:0

value
59863902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d5b274c04d2bc90a8ea1901ebf2bf0d83fdc826 OP_EQUAL
address
38k39mgTW1S6ZiDqqTzADYRfWLPbLJpVCP
transaction
28158bbb7f84c113183d7e5783137067c79cf4d00a12dcb6ec8548fc6d852b8d
spent
true